aboutsummaryrefslogtreecommitdiffstats
path: root/testing/emacs/noaslr-dump.patch
blob: ccacb3c3341e843e7829bd88e10f1777b9e12d4a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
diff -urw orig/src/Makefile.in src/src/Makefile.in
--- orig/src/Makefile.in	2015-02-09 14:14:38.576648826 +0000
+++ src/src/Makefile.in	2015-02-09 14:15:11.662322918 +0000
@@ -455,6 +455,7 @@
 ifeq ($(CANNOT_DUMP),yes)
 	ln -f temacs$(EXEEXT) $@
 else
+	paxmark -r temacs$(EXEEXT)
 	LC_ALL=C $(RUN_TEMACS) -batch -l loadup dump
 	$(PAXCTL_if_present) -zex $@
 	ln -f $@ bootstrap-emacs$(EXEEXT)
@@ -659,6 +660,7 @@
 ifeq ($(CANNOT_DUMP),yes)
 	ln -f temacs$(EXEEXT) $@
 else
+	paxmark -r temacs$(EXEEXT)
 	$(RUN_TEMACS) --batch --load loadup bootstrap
 	$(PAXCTL_if_present) -zex emacs$(EXEEXT)
 	mv -f emacs$(EXEEXT) $@